Steps to Take After the Accident
The actions you take immediately following the accident can have a major impact on your ability to recover compensation later on. Here are the key steps we recommend taking if you’re hit by an uninsured DUI driver:
- Call the police immediately. A police report documenting the accident and the driver’s intoxication is crucial evidence.
- Seek medical attention right away. Even if you don’t think you’re seriously injured, some injuries may not be immediately apparent.
- Gather evidence at the scene. Take photos of vehicle damage, injuries, road conditions, etc. Get contact info for any witnesses.
- Do not accept any money from the driver. This could jeopardize your ability to seek full compensation later.
- Do not admit fault or apologize. Anything you say could potentially be used against you.
- Contact your own insurance company. Report the accident, but don’t give a recorded statement without speaking to an attorney first.
- Keep detailed records. Document all medical treatment, expenses, missed work, etc. related to the accident.
- Consult with an experienced attorney ASAP. The sooner you have legal representation, the better protected your rights will be.

Options for Recovering Compensation
When you’re hit by an uninsured DUI driver, it may seem like your options for compensation are limited. However, there are still several potential avenues we can pursue to help you recover damages. Here are some of the main options our attorneys explore:
1. Your Own Uninsured Motorist Coverage
If you have uninsured motorist (UM) coverage as part of your auto insurance policy, this can be a primary source of compensation. UM coverage is designed specifically to protect you in situations where you’re hit by an uninsured driver. It can help cover med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and other damages up to your policy limits.
2. Personal Injury Lawsuit Against the Driver
Even if the drunk driver has no insurance, you can still file a civil lawsuit against them personally. While they may not have insurance to cover damages, we can potentially recover compensation from their personal assets or future earnings. This may involve garnishing their wages or putting liens on their property.
3. Dram Shop Liability
In some cases, we may be able to hold the bar, restaurant, or other establishment that served alcohol to the drunk driver liable under dram shop laws. If they knowingly over-served an obviously intoxicated person, they could share responsibility for the accident.
4. Employer Liability
If the drunk driver was on the job at the time of the accident, their employer could potentially be held liable under the doctrine of respondeat superior. This allows us to pursue damages from the company’s insurance policy.
5. Victim Compensation Funds
Many states have crime victim compensation funds that provide financial assistance to DUI accident victims. While these typically have caps on payouts, they can help cover medical bills and lost wages.
6. Health Insurance
Your health insurance can help cover your medical expenses related to the accident. We can work with your insurance company to ensure all eligible treatments are covered.
7. MedPay Coverage
If you have Medical Payments (MedPay) coverage on your auto insurance policy, this can help pay for your medical bills regardless of who was at fault.
8. Underinsured Motorist Coverage

The Importance of Uninsured Motorist Coverage
One of the most valuable protections you can have on your auto insurance policy is uninsured motorist (UM) coverage. This type of coverage is specifically designed to protect you in situations where you’re hit by a driver with no insurance – like in a DUI accident scenario. Here’s why UM coverage is so crucial:
Financial Protection
UM coverage provides a safety net to help cover your medical bills, lost wages, and other damages when the at-fault driver has no insurance to compensate you. Without it, you could be left footing the bill for expenses that weren’t your fault.
Covers Hit-and-Run Accidents
In addition to uninsured drivers, UM coverage typically applies in hit-and-run accidents where the at-fault driver flees the scene. This is particularly relevant in DUI cases where intoxicated drivers may panic and leave the accident site.
Relatively Inexpensive
Compared to other types of auto insurance coverage, UM coverage is generally quite affordable. The peace of mind it provides is well worth the modest additional premium.
Protects You as a Pedestrian or Cyclist
UM coverage doesn’t just apply when you’re in your car. It also protects you if you’re hit by an uninsured driver while walking, biking, or even as a passenger in someone else’s vehicle.
Covers All Household Members
Your UM coverage typically extends to all members of your household, providing protection for your entire family.
Higher Limits Available
While state minimums for UM coverage are often low, you can usually purchase higher limits for more comprehensive protection. We recommend getting the highest limits you can reasonably afford.
Stackable in Some States

The Legal Process for Uninsured DUI Accident Claims
Navigating the legal process after being hit by an uninsured DUI driver can be complex and overwhelming. At Spodek Law Group, we guide our clients through every step to ensure their rights are protected and they receive fair compensation. Here’s an overview of what you can expect:
1. Initial Consultation
The process begins with a free consultation where we’ll review the details of your case, assess your options, and explain how we can help. This is your chance to ask questions and get a clear understanding of the road ahead.
2. Investigation
Our team will conduct a thorough investigation of the accident, gathering evidence such as police reports, witness statements, medical records, and any available surveillance footage. We’ll also look into the drunk driver’s background and assets.
3. Filing Insurance Claims
We’ll handle all communication with insurance companies, including filing claims with your own insurer for uninsured motorist coverage if applicable. We’ll ensure all deadlines are met and proper documentation is submitted.
4. Negotiation
Once we’ve built a strong case, we’ll enter into negotiations with the relevant parties. This could include your own insurance company, the drunk driver’s attorney (if they have one), or other potentially liable parties like a bar that over-served the driver.
5. Filing a Lawsuit
If a fair settlement can’t be reached through negotiation, we’ll file a lawsuit on your behalf. This involves drafting and filing a complaint in court detailing your injuries and damages.
6. Discovery
During the discovery phase, both sides exchange information related to the case. This may involve written questions (interrogatories), requests for documents, and depositions (sworn out-of-court testimony).
7. Mediation or Arbitration
Many cases are resolved through alternative dispute resolution methods like mediation or arbitration before going to trial. We’ll represent your interests throughout these proceedings.
8. Trial
If necessary, we’re fully prepared to take your case to trial. Our experienced litigators will present a compelling case to the judge or jury, fighting for the full compensation you deserve.
9. Appeal
If the outcome of the trial is unsatisfactory, we can file an appeal to a higher court if there are grounds to do so.
10. Collection
Once a settlement or verdict is reached, we’ll work diligently to collect the compensation you’re owed. Potential Damages You Can Recover
When you’re hit by an uninsured DUI driver, you may be entitled to various types of compensation for your losses and suffering. At Spodek Law Group, we fight tirelessly to ensure our clients receive full and fair compensation for ALL damages they’ve incurred. Here are some of the main types of damages we may pursue on your behalf:
Type of Damage | Description |
---|---|
Medical Expenses | All costs related to your injury treatment, including hospital bills, surgeries, medications, physical therapy, and future medical care |
Lost Wages | Compensation for income lost due to time off work for recovery, as well as potential future lost earnings if your injuries impact your ability to work |
Pain and Suffering | Non-economic damages for physical pain and emotional distress caused by the accident and injuries |
Property Damage | Costs to repair or replace your vehicle and any other personal property damaged in the crash |
Loss of Enjoyment of Life | Compensation for how your injuries have negatively impacted your ability to enjoy daily activities and hobbies |
Emotional Distress | Damages for psychological trauma, anxiety, depression, or PTSD resulting from the accident |
Punitive Damages | In cases of extreme recklessness, additional damages may be awarded to punish the drunk driver and deter similar behavior |
Loss of Consortium | Compensation for the impact of your injuries on your relationship with your spouse |
Disfigurement | Damages for permanent scarring or other visible effects of your injuries |
Disability | Compensation if your injuries result in temporary or permanent disability |
It’s important to note that the specific damages you may be eligible for will depend on the unique circumstances of your case.
